Helena Resano recounts how badly she has been through the coronavirus: “We thought my daughter was not going to come back” | Television on Cadena SER

The journalist Helena Resano is one of the more than 600,000 people infected with coronavirus that has been registered since the pandemic began in our country. This Wednesday, the presenter of the news of The sixth was in a program of that chain to tell in the first person how bad it can be to go through this disease and denounce the mismanagement of the Community of Madrid.

Their 18-year-old daughter had symptoms that they thought “it was a cold or sore throat” but the whole family had a PCR. Resano, who was asymptomatic, was tested at the company and 24 hours later he already knew the result: it was positive. Her daughter, who was tested at the health center, had the same diagnosis but did not know it until 5 days later and her husband and son had to wait 8 days to find out that they were also infected. She knows she is lucky to have had the opportunity to do the PCR at the company quickly. But he criticizes that the deadlines are so slow in public health and the situation in which health professionals find themselves again: “In the health center they are collapsed. They do not give enough, they are doing thousands of hours. All that work and deployment of personnel and resources is not working for anything. “

Resano also explains that during this time no tracker has contacted them and the risk that this entails, added to the delay in results: “We could have continued to spread, but fortunately in my case there was a PCR in my company that helped us to confine ourselves and then to notify our own contacts “.

“My 18-year-old daughter was ill, a healthy girl, with no previous pathologies”

The journalist has also shared the moments of anguish she has experienced due to the health of her 18-year-old daughter, the only one in the family who did have symptoms of the disease. A healthy girl, without previous pathologies: “There have been three days that were worrying. Emma has just turned 18 and was really bad, with a very high fever, she could hardly move, we had to do it between my husband and I, bathe her … constantly falling asleep, with a lot of pain and never going back, “she said.

Resano confesses that he came to fear the worst: “Fortunately I have a doctor brother and friends who were guiding us, but there was a moment that we thought was not going to go back “. They told him that the fever would begin to go down and, from the third day, it did.
